Find the value of x that will make A||B.<br> A<br> B<br> 4x<br> 2x<br> X =<br> ?
pashok25 [27]

Answer:

x = 30

Step-by-step explanation:

Lines A and B are parallel lines and a transverse line is intersecting these lines at two distinct points.

By the definition of interior consecutive angles, sum of the measures of interior consecutive angles is 180°.

4x + 2x = 180°

6x = 180

x = 30

Therefore x = 30 will be the answer.

Please solve ILL MARK YOU BRAINIEST!!!!!!!
sweet [91]

Answer:

14. 4 + x - 2

15. 8k - 3k

16. 5 + 2y + 15

Step-by-step explanation:

14. "sum" means adding, "minus" means subtract

sum of four and x: 4 + x

minus two: 4 + x - 2

15. "product" means multiplying, "decreased by" means subtract, "times" means multiply

the product of k and 8: 8k

three times k: 3k

the product of k and 8 decreased by three times k: 8k - 3k

(Depending on what the question is asking, you may or may not need to simplify this to 5k (8k - 3k = 5k))

16. "more" means add, "plus" means add, "twice" means multiply by two

five: 5

plus twice y:  5 + 2y

fifteen more: 5 + 2y + 15
